Sanitary panties and menstrual pad belts (1946-47, U.S.A.)

This page from the American Sears, Roebuck Fall-Winter catalog of 1946-47 shows the variety of "sanitary" (menstrual) panties and belts to hold menstrual pads available to women; different styles appeared later. Almost all of these disappeared in the early 1970s, when self-adhesive sanitary napkins appeared (see New Freedom and Stayfree), much to the relief of most women.
